Can Synthetic Oil Freeze. Motor oil can and will freeze solid given cold enough ambient temperatures. When motor oil freezes, it takes on a thicker consistency and loses its ability to lubricate an engine properly. But not all oils gel up at the same point. That’s why it’s important to use synthetic oils that have a lower pour point than conventional oils. And the freezing process causes predictable changes in oil behavior. However, synthetic oil has a lower pour point, making it less likely to solidify in frigid. In fact, if you start your car with frozen oil, it can cause serious damage to the engine components. The improved flow properties of synthetic oil allow it to reach critical engine components faster, reducing wear and tear caused by cold starts.
